Cassandra Diaz webcomic: My Grandmother's House
A while ago I mentioned that Sam Weber turned me on to Cassandra Diaz's work. I now have the pleasure of publishing her comic My Grandmother's House -- an ethereal , dreamy moment -- on Tor.com. Check it out. I'm still blown away that she's just out of school.

Kekai Kotaki and The Great Hunt
The second Wheel of Time ebook cover is now released, this one by the amazing Kekai Kotaki . You can read a behind-the-scenes post and see lots of progressions on Tor.com: The Great Hunt ebook cover by Kekai Kotaki. RELATED: David Grove's ebook cover for The Eye of the Wolrd

Art that's a lot like hiking
Storm King Art Center is always magical. Went for the Maya Lin, and to revisit the Andy Goldworthy, and was reminded how much I love Richard Serra .

Donato demo download from Massive Black
Just out from Massive Black's downloadable demo series: Donato Giancola's "The Mechanic." Long term readers know I've seen Donato demo a bunch of times, he's a born teacher. $60 dollars for 5 hours. Download version available now, there will be a DVD version out in November. Order it here . ...
